Gold seems to be moving opposite of the dollar index lately. Anyone else notice that? When the dollar is strong, gold seems to dip, and vice versa. Might be a good way to confirm your XAUUSD trades, just keep an eye on the DXY too. Still learning how these correlations work though...

Hi @jennifer684, I've definitely noticed that inverse correlation between gold and the DXY too. It's not always perfect, of course, but it's been a pretty reliable indicator lately. When the dollar strengthens, it generally makes gold more expensive for holders of other currencies, hence the dip. Conversely, a weaker dollar often provides a tailwind. I'm cautious about opening new positions until after the Fed announcement, but keeping an eye on the DXY is a smart move for confirmation. Sometimes, though, that news about geopolitical tensions can override the DXY's influence, as we've seen recently where gold hasn't reacted as strongly as expected. It's a complex dance!
